Lucknow, June 25 -- The Uttar Pradesh government has announced the formation of a new Economic Advisory Group (EAG) designed to provide independent and specialized economic counsel on various economic and policy matters.

The advisory body, constituted to help the state make informed long-term strategic decisions, will focus on evaluating governmental programs and policies while promoting economic stability, inclusive development, and fiscal discipline.

The 15-member advisory group will be coordinated by Nachiketa Tiwari from IIT Kanpur, who will serve as the group coordinator. The diverse panel includes prominent industry leaders and experts from various sectors critical to economic development.
